Adaptive iterative learning control based on IF–THEN rules and data-driven scheme for a class of nonlinear discrete-time systems

被引:0
作者
Chidentree Treesatayapun
机构
[1] CINVESTAV-Saltillo,Department of Robotic and Advanced Manufacturing
来源
Soft Computing | 2018年 / 22卷
关键词
Iterative learning control; Data-driven control; Discrete-time systems; Adaptive control; DC motor; Neuro-fuzzy;
D O I
暂无
中图分类号
学科分类号
摘要
An adaptive iterative learning controller (ILC) is designed for a class of nonlinear discrete-time systems based on data driving control (DDC) scheme and adaptive networks called fuzzy rules emulated network (FREN). The proposed control law is derived by using DDC scheme with a compact form dynamic linearization for iterative systems. The pseudo-partial derivative of linearization model is estimated by the proposed tuning algorithm and FREN established by human knowledge of controlled plants within the format of IF–THEN rules related on input–output data set. An on-line learning algorithm is proposed to compensate unknown nonlinear terms of controlled plant, and the controller allows to change desired trajectories for other iterations. The performance of control scheme is verified by theoretical analysis under reasonable assumptions which can be held for a general class of practical controlled plants. The experimental system is constructed by a commercial DC motor current control to confirm the effectiveness and applicability. The comparison results are addressed with a general ILC scheme based on DDC.
引用
收藏
页码:487 / 497
页数:10
相关论文
共 50 条
  • [41] Resilient iterative learning control for a class of discrete-time nonlinear systems under hybrid attacks
    Zhao, Xuyang
    Yin, Yanling
    Bu, Xuhui
    ASIAN JOURNAL OF CONTROL, 2023, 25 (02) : 1167 - 1179
  • [42] Performance-based data-driven model-free adaptive sliding mode control for a class of discrete-time nonlinear processes
    Liu, Dong
    Yang, Guang-Hong
    JOURNAL OF PROCESS CONTROL, 2018, 68 : 186 - 194
  • [43] Data-Driven Control for Linear Discrete-Time Delay Systems
    Rueda-Escobedo, Juan G.
    Fridman, Emilia
    Schiffer, Johannes
    IEEE TRANSACTIONS ON AUTOMATIC CONTROL, 2022, 67 (07) : 3321 - 3336
  • [44] A new adaptive iterative learning control motivated by discrete-time adaptive control
    Chi, Ronghu
    Hou, Zhongsheng
    Sui, Shulin
    Yu, Lei
    Yao, Wenlong
    INTERNATIONAL JOURNAL OF INNOVATIVE COMPUTING INFORMATION AND CONTROL, 2008, 4 (06): : 1267 - 1274
  • [45] Iterative Learning Control for Discrete-Time Nonlinear Systems Based on Adaptive Tuning of 2D Learning Gain
    Yu, Xian
    Hou, Zhongsheng
    Yin, Chenkun
    PROCEEDINGS OF THE 36TH CHINESE CONTROL CONFERENCE (CCC 2017), 2017, : 3581 - 3586
  • [46] Varying-sliding condition adaptive controller for a class of unknown discrete-time systems with data-driven model
    Treesatayapun C.
    International Journal of Modelling, Identification and Control, 2017, 27 (03) : 210 - 218
  • [47] Adaptive iterative learning control of discrete-time systems with unknown nonlinearity
    Li Jing
    Li Jun-min
    PROCEEDINGS OF 2005 CHINESE CONTROL AND DECISION CONFERENCE, VOLS 1 AND 2, 2005, : 463 - 466
  • [48] Dual-staged optimal iterative learning control for a class of nonlinear discrete-time systems
    Chi Rong-hu
    Hou Zhong-sheng
    Proceedings of 2005 Chinese Control and Decision Conference, Vols 1 and 2, 2005, : 852 - 856
  • [49] Robust higher-order iterative learning control for a class of nonlinear discrete-time systems
    Kim, YT
    Lee, H
    Noh, HS
    Bien, ZZ
    2003 IEEE INTERNATIONAL CONFERENCE ON SYSTEMS, MAN AND CYBERNETICS, VOLS 1-5, CONFERENCE PROCEEDINGS, 2003, : 2219 - 2224
  • [50] A Data-driven Iterative Learning Control for I/O Constrained Nonlinear Systems
    Chi, Ronghu
    Liu, Xiaohe
    Lin, Na
    Zhang, Ruikun
    2016 14TH INTERNATIONAL CONFERENCE ON CONTROL, AUTOMATION, ROBOTICS AND VISION (ICARCV), 2016,